Unicode Character "𝅵" (U+1D175)

The character 𝅵 (Musical Symbol Begin Tie) is represented by the Unicode codepoint U+1D175. It is encoded in the Musical Symbols block, which belongs to the Supplementary Multilingual Plane. It was added to Unicode in version 3.1 (March, 2001). It is HTML encoded as 𝅵.
